What is the advantage of a heat pump over a traditional AC and furnace system?

Heat pumps provide both heating and cooling from a single system, eliminating the need for a separate furnace. In heating mode, heat pumps move heat rather than generating it, making them 2-4 times more efficient than electric resistance heating. They work best in climates like Birmingham's where winters are mild.

Do heat pumps work in Alabama winter temperatures?

Modern heat pumps work effectively down to temperatures well below what Birmingham typically experiences. For backup during extreme cold snaps, dual-fuel heat pumps combine a heat pump with a gas or propane furnace that activates below a set outdoor temperature.
